Output 32df040dec40e1c98a2bed4caf0a3fe658ab7f72ea24d19740636bb2515ac8ec:20

value
138571330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61c0752b7d50e96a132a8ed142bb7f4ab98ce644 OP_EQUAL
address
MGp2LETR71khSWjmva4ingEXPKRv6VF5qB
transaction
32df040dec40e1c98a2bed4caf0a3fe658ab7f72ea24d19740636bb2515ac8ec
spent
true